Turks and Caicos – Is This the Ultimate Seclusion?

I’ll never forget my first sunrise on Grace Bay Beach—it felt like a private screening just for me. The powder‑white sand and shallow, crystal‑clear water make Turks and Caicos a no‑brainer for total relaxation.

Every morning, I strolled along the shoreline, stopping at local cafés for fresh coffee and conch fritters. By midday, I was snorkeling over coral walls, spotting parrotfish and turtles with ease.

In the evening, I found hidden beach bars playing reggae under tiki torches—talk about laid‑back vibes. If you crave solitude without giving up luxe amenities, this island ranks top among beach vacations.

My insider tip? Book a beachfront villa with plunge pool—you’ll thank me when you sip sunset cocktails from your terrace.


2:St. Lucia – Can Romance and Adventure Coexist?

Imagine hiking verdant trails by day and soaking in volcanic hot springs by night—that’s St. Lucia for me. The iconic Pitons rising from the sea set the scene for a picture‑perfect adventure.

I kayaked alongside mangroves, then swapped my paddle for a spa robe at a hilltop resort with panoramic island views. The contrast between adrenaline and zen was a total game‑changer.

Foodies, rejoice: I discovered local street stalls serving bouyon soup that warmed me to the core. Dining with a Pitons backdrop? Simply magical.

For couples who want a little thrill with their chill, St. Lucia delivers one of the most dynamic beach vacations you’ll find in 2025.


3:The Bahamas – Why Is This a Family Favorite?

When I traveled with my niece and nephew, the Bahamas was our playground. The calm, shallow waters are perfect for little splashers and the countless family resorts have water parks galore.

One afternoon, we fed pigs on the beach (yes, REALLY) at Exuma, then watched fireworks light the sky over Nassau by night. The mix of quirky adventures and classic island charm kept us all engaged.

I snagged a kayak at sunset and floated past hidden coves—talk about a bonding moment. Families, take note: you won’t find many beach vacations that cater so well to every age.

Pro tip: Rent a cottage on Eleuthera for ultimate privacy and let the kids roam free—safety first, but fun all the way.

Maui, Hawaii – Is This Island Overrated?

I used to think Maui was just hype—until I drove the Road to Hana at dawn and saw waterfalls spilling into the ocean. The sacred vibe hit me immediately.

My favorite spot: Makena Beach, where lava‑rock coves create private swimming holes. I spent hours snorkeling with sea turtles before grabbing poke bowls from a roadside stand.

Sunset at Haleakalā National Park? Unreal. I watched the sun rise above the clouds—total bucket‑list material. Maui combines beach vacations with epic landscapes like nowhere else.

Want solitude? Head to secluded east‑side beaches at sunrise. Trust me, you’ll be stoked by how empty the shoreline feels.

6:Outer Banks, North Carolina – Is This a Hidden Gem?

If you want East Coast sand dunes minus the crowds, OBX is your spot. I rented a dune buggy and raced along miles of untamed shoreline—the wind in my hair, salt on my lips.

Lighthouses, wild horses, and ghost crabs made every day feel like a living postcard. I even tried kiteboarding on the ocean side—talk about an adrenaline rush.

Come evening, I grilled fresh shrimp on my deck and watched bioluminescent plankton light up the surf. It felt like magic.

For a mix of adventure, history, and laid‑back vibes, Outer Banks ranks high among beach vacations you need in 2025.

Amalfi Coast, Italy – Can You Beat Coastal Charm?

Picture colorful cliffside villages stacked above sapphire waters—that’s Amalfi for me. I rented a scooter, weaving through lemon groves and tasting limoncello at family‑run farms.

Each day ended with a seaside dinner of seafood pasta so fresh, it tasted like ocean spray. I sipped local wine while watching fishing boats drift home.

Hidden beaches accessible only by boat became my secret spots: fewer tourists, better selfies. This blend of history, food, and scenery makes Amalfi a top beach vacation.

My must‑do: hike the Path of the Gods at dawn—trust me, the views are unforgettable and worth the early alarm.


8:Santorini, Greece – Is This the Ultimate Sunset Spot?

Santorini’s blue‑domed churches and whitewashed lanes are more than postcard pretty—they feel otherworldly at sunset. I watched the sun melt into the Aegean from Oia’s cliffside terraces.

During the day, I explored volcanic beaches with black and red sand. Swimming in thermal springs near ancient ruins? Totally surreal.

The island’s local cuisine—fava beans, feta pie, fresh octopus—turned every meal into an event. Paired with chilled Assyrtiko wine, it was heaven.

For romance, photography, or just pure awe, Santorini nails it as one of the most iconic beach vacations in 2025.


9:Algarve, Portugal – Why Is This a Sun‑Lover’s Paradise?

Golden cliffs, secret grottoes, and hidden caves—Algarve made me feel like an explorer. I hopped a boat into Benagil Cave, then lounged on Praia da Marinha’s pristine sand.

The seafood shacks lining the coast served grilled sardines that made me rethink all other fish dishes. Every meal felt authentic and heart‑warming.

I discovered cliff‑top trails with panoramic views and zero crowds if you go early. For me, Algarve defines the perfect blend of exploration and chill.

Portugal’s southern coast is a sleeper hit for beach vacations—sunny, budget‑friendly, and oh‑so‑stunning.

Phuket, Thailand – Is This Worth the Buzz?

Phuket can be party‑heavy, but I found slices of serenity on its less‑crowded west coast. I stayed near Kamala Beach, where local markets buzz by day and lantern festivals glow by night.

I took a longtail boat to Phi Phi Islands, snorkeling through crystalline waters teeming with tropical fish. Later, I savored street‑food stalls dishing out spicy tom yum with perfect balance.

Sunset yoga on Kata Beach became my ritual—just me, the sound of waves, and the sky turning pink. For me, Phuket balances culture, cuisine, and sunbathing better than most beach vacations.

Pro tip: Hire a scooter and explore hidden bays—trust me, you’ll discover spots untouched by guidebooks.

Fiji – Is This the Friendliest Island?

Fiji’s warmth isn’t just in its water—it’s in its people. I was greeted with flower garlands and “Bula!” everywhere I went. That spirit made every moment glow.

My beachfront bure had hammocks strung between palm trees, perfect for afternoon naps. I snorkeled rainbow‑reef channels and joined kava ceremonies with local chiefs.

Evenings meant communal feasts under thatched roofs, where I tried lovo‑cooked meats buried in hot stones. The vibe was equal parts festive and heartfelt.

For a beach vacation that feels like visiting family, Fiji tops my list. It’s laid‑back, culturally rich, and endlessly welcoming.


14:Gold Coast, Australia – Surf, Sun, & Serious Style?

When I think Gold Coast, I think epic surf breaks and skyline views. I caught dawn waves at Snapper Rocks, then hit rooftop bars in Surfers Paradise by sunset.

The beaches stretch for miles—perfect for long walks or rollerblading past skyscrapers. I also discovered hidden coves at Burleigh Heads, where I swam in peace.

Dining was a treat: fresh Moreton Bay bugs at seaside cafés, paired with Aussie rosé that tastes like summer in a glass.

Gold Coast nails the balance between city slicker style and laid‑back beach vacations. If you want both, it’s a no‑brainer for 2025.
